Abstract

Content-related activities in the EU ACTS (Advanced Communication Technology and Services) Programme are grouped in the Multimedia Content Manipulation and Management domain, part of a larger Multimedia area. Virtual production in a distributed environment is a cornerstone of content-related activities with two large projects in this area. But virtual studios are only one element of a much wider set of activities shaping the future of content. R&D activities in this group show that as communication applications become more sophisticated, they increasingly borrow from the advanced content creation tool box.
